The sum of the first five terms of an arithmetic sequence is 90 less than the sum of the next five terms. What is the absolute difference between two consecutive terms of this sequence
the absolute difference between two consecutive terms of this arithmetic sequence is 18.
Let's denote the first term of the arithmetic sequence as 'a' and the common difference as 'd'.
The sum of the first five terms can be expressed as:
S1 = a + (a + d) + (a + 2d) + (a + 3d) + (a + 4d)
The sum of the next five terms can be expressed as:
S2 = (a + 5d) + (a + 6d) + (a + 7d) + (a + 8d) + (a + 9d)
According to the given information, the sum of the first five terms is 90 less than the sum of the next five terms:
S1 = S2 - 90
Substituting the expressions for S1 and S2:
a + (a + d) + (a + 2d) + (a + 3d) + (a + 4d) = (a + 5d) + (a + 6d) + (a + 7d) + (a + 8d) + (a + 9d) - 90
Simplifying the equation:
5a + 10d = 5a + 15d - 90
Canceling out the common terms:
10d = 15d - 90
Rearranging the equation:
5d = 90
Dividing both sides by 5:
d = 18
Now that we have the common difference 'd', we can find the absolute difference between two consecutive terms by subtracting one term from the next. In this case, the absolute difference is equal to the common difference 'd':
Absolute difference between two consecutive terms = d = 18

If a is an odd integer and b is an even integer, which of the following makes an odd integer?
A.) 3b
B.) a+3
C.) 2(a+b)
D.) a+2b
Explain your answer
9514 1404 393
Answer:
D.) a+2b
Step-by-step explanation:
The integers 'a' and 'b' can be any, so you can choose a couple and evaluate these expressions to see what you get. For example, we can let a=1 and b=0. For these values, the offered expressions evaluate to ...
A) 3(0) = 0 . . . even
B) 1 +3 = 4 . . . even
C) 2(1+0) = 2 . . . even
D) 1 +2(0) = 1 . . . odd
_____
Additional comment
These rules apply to even/odd:
odd × odd = oddodd × even = eveneven × even = evenodd + odd = evenodd + even = oddeven + even = evenThen A is (odd)(even) = even; B is (odd)+(odd) = even; C is (even)(whatever) = even; D = (odd)+(even) = odd.
